Sandwich Structures with Composite Inserts: Experimental Studies
Abstract Studies are presented on the performance of insert assemblies of the sandwich structures with localized through-the-thickness compressive loading. Through-the-thickness and partially inserted fully potted inserts are studied. Insert material considered are: aluminum and 3D woven composite. Experimental results are compared with analytical predictions. It is observed that the specific strength of 3D woven composite inserts is more than that of aluminum inserts.
